Pakistan Eyes Chinese Robotics Partnerships

Pakistan explored new technology partnerships with Chinese robotics companies at the 2026 World Robot Conference (WRC 2026) in Beijing.

The conference ran from August 19 to 23 at the Beiren Etrong International Exhibition and Convention Center E-Town. It brought together more than 300 exhibiting companies and showcased over 3,000 innovative products.

The event highlighted China’s growing role in robotics, embodied artificial intelligence, and smart manufacturing.

Strong International Participation

Held under the theme “Human-Robot Symbiosis, Production-Demand Convergence,” the conference attracted record international participation.

More than 30 international organizations supported the event. International guests also accounted for around 30% of participants at the main forum.

Moreover, the conference featured 311 newly launched products, reflecting the rapid development of the global robotics industry.

Pakistan Eyes New Technology Partnerships

Pakistani technology delegations, researchers, and trade representatives used the conference to explore partnerships with leading Chinese robotics enterprises.

Their discussions focused on opportunities for technology cooperation, industrial modernization, and digital transformation.

For Pakistan, the event also highlighted potential opportunities under CPEC Phase II. The next phase places greater emphasis on high-tech cooperation, industrial upgrading, and digital development.

China’s Robotics Sector Expands

The conference demonstrated how China’s robotics industry is moving beyond laboratory research toward commercial applications.

International visitors also highlighted the growing accessibility of China for technology professionals and business communities.

Furthermore, the rapid development of practical robotics applications is attracting greater international interest in China’s technology ecosystem.

Beijing Strengthens Role as Robotics Hub

Beijing E-Town continues to strengthen its position as an international center for robotics and smart manufacturing.

The conference provided a platform for companies, researchers, and investors to exchange ideas and explore new partnerships.

As a result, Pakistan’s participation could help create new opportunities for cooperation in robotics, artificial intelligence, and advanced manufacturing.

CPEC Phase II and High-Tech Cooperation

The growing interest in robotics aligns with the broader objectives of CPEC Phase II. Pakistan can potentially benefit from Chinese expertise in automation, smart factories, robotics, and digital technologies.

In addition, deeper collaboration could support industrial productivity and help Pakistani businesses adopt advanced manufacturing solutions.

The WRC 2026 therefore offered an important platform for Pakistan to connect with China’s rapidly expanding robotics ecosystem.
